Los iframes, o marcos en línea, son elementos HTML que permiten incrustar otra página HTML dentro de una página principal. Son una herramienta útil para los desarrolladores web porque ofrecen una manera de insertar contenido de un sitio web diferente sin romper la continuidad de la página principal. Esta característica es especialmente valiosa para cargar contenido como vídeos, mapas o incluso documentos interactivos sin afectar la estructura global del sitio web.
¿Cómo funcionan los iframes?
Para usar un iframe, simplemente se incluye el elemento <iframe> en el HTML de la página y se especifica una URL en el atributo src. Esto le dice al navegador que cargue la página web indicada dentro del espacio definido por el elemento iframe. Por ejemplo:
El contenido de la URL especificada se mostrará dentro del marco del iframe, actuando como una ventana a otro recurso web.
Configuraciones comunes para iframes
Tamaño: Puedes controlar el tamaño del iframe mediante los atributos width y height, que determinan el ancho y alto del iframe en la página.
Seguridad: El atributo sandbox puede añadir capas adicionales de restricciones de seguridad, limitando lo que el contenido dentro del iframe puede hacer.
Origen: El atributo srcdoc permite especificar el contenido HTML directamente dentro del iframe, en lugar de cargar una URL.
Consideraciones de seguridad
El uso de iframes no está exento de preocupaciones de seguridad. Los ataques de ""clickjacking"", por ejemplo, pueden engañar a los usuarios para que hagan clic en elementos dentro de un iframe que parecen pertenecer a la página principal. Por esta razón, es crucial asegurarse de que el contenido incrustado proviene de fuentes de confianza y de configurar adecuadamente las políticas de seguridad del navegador.
Conclusión
Los iframes son una parte poderosa de la tecnología web que permite una integración de contenido flexible y funcional. Sin embargo, como con cualquier tecnología, su uso requiere consideración cuidadosa, especialmente en lo que respecta a la seguridad y al rendimiento del sitio web. Correctamente utilizados, los iframes pueden mejorar significativamente la experiencia del usuario al proporcionar integraciones útiles y pertinentes.
Los iframes, o marcos en línea, son elementos HTML que permiten incrustar otra página HTML dentro de una página principal. Son una herramienta útil para los desarrolladores web porque ofrecen una manera de insertar contenido de un sitio web diferente sin romper la continuidad de la página principal. Esta característica es especialmente valiosa para cargar contenido como vídeos, mapas o incluso documentos interactivos sin afectar la estructura global del sitio web.
¿Cómo funcionan los iframes?
Para usar un iframe, simplemente se incluye el elemento
<iframe>
en el HTML de la página y se especifica una URL en el atributosrc
. Esto le dice al navegador que cargue la página web indicada dentro del espacio definido por el elemento iframe. Por ejemplo:El contenido de la URL especificada se mostrará dentro del marco del iframe, actuando como una ventana a otro recurso web.
Configuraciones comunes para iframes
width
yheight
, que determinan el ancho y alto del iframe en la página.sandbox
puede añadir capas adicionales de restricciones de seguridad, limitando lo que el contenido dentro del iframe puede hacer.srcdoc
permite especificar el contenido HTML directamente dentro del iframe, en lugar de cargar una URL.Consideraciones de seguridad
El uso de iframes no está exento de preocupaciones de seguridad. Los ataques de ""clickjacking"", por ejemplo, pueden engañar a los usuarios para que hagan clic en elementos dentro de un iframe que parecen pertenecer a la página principal. Por esta razón, es crucial asegurarse de que el contenido incrustado proviene de fuentes de confianza y de configurar adecuadamente las políticas de seguridad del navegador.
Conclusión
Los iframes son una parte poderosa de la tecnología web que permite una integración de contenido flexible y funcional. Sin embargo, como con cualquier tecnología, su uso requiere consideración cuidadosa, especialmente en lo que respecta a la seguridad y al rendimiento del sitio web. Correctamente utilizados, los iframes pueden mejorar significativamente la experiencia del usuario al proporcionar integraciones útiles y pertinentes.